Assess

Assess verb - To make an approximate or tentative judgment regarding.
Usage example: let's step back and assess the situation

Analyze and assess are semantically related. In some cases you can use "Analyze" instead a verb "Assess".

Analyze

Analyze verb - To identify and examine the basic elements or parts of (something) especially for discovering interrelationships.
Usage example: analyze the park's ecosystem before deciding whether hunting should be allowed

Assess and analyze are semantically related. Sometimes you can use "Assess" instead a verb "Analyze".
